Coming Soon Lincoln Park

Mundano will be a neighborhood restaurant that promises a forward-thinking experience. The name “Mundano” originates from the Spanish word for “worldly” and Chef Ross Henke took this into account when building the menu. Henke intends to draw from his experience with Latin American cuisine but will lean heavily on a more New American style, blending a variety of influences and cooking techniques to create a spectrum of flavors both striking and memorable. The menu will rotate as the primary inspiration will rely on seasonality and sustainability of ingredients. To compliment, the beverage program will be built around agave spirits and natural wines and will also include an approachable list of classic cocktails. As for the vibe, Henke has playfully dubbed Mundano the “Logan Square Embassy,” with the intent on bringing more of the relaxed, innovative dining experience synonymous with Logan Square to Lincoln Park. 

Executive Chef Ross Henke – Ambitious to further his career in the hospitality industry, Chef Ross Henke dove headfirst into Chicago’s thriving restaurant scene in 2011. Over the ensuing years, he honed his skills in the kitchens of some of the city’s premier establishments including LM Bistro at the downtown Hotel Felix and in the West Loop at Publican Quality Meats and The Publican, working under the guidance of James Beard Award-winning Executive Chef/Partner Paul Kahan. As Executive Chef of Quiote in Logan Square, Henke garnered numerous accolades including a Michelin Bib Gourmand in both 2017 and 2018 as well as a top spot on Chicago Magazine's “Best New Restaurant” list. Henke’s penchant for taking risks in the kitchen and passion for creating “cravable” dishes in novel ways earned him a nomination for the Jean Banchet Award for Best Chef de Cuisine in 2017.

Front of House Manager Trista Baker – Alabama native Trista Baker has been diligently working her way up in the hospitality industry for the past decade, holding down nearly every front-of-house position from hosting to serving to managing. Witnessing the lack of resources for Chicago’s many restaurant industry employees, she decided to take action. In 2018, Baker founded the Restaurant Culture Association—a non-profit organization set to transform the industry through education and policy reform. Her continued work with RCA focuses on assisting restaurant and bar owners in not only preventing sexual harassment, but also providing a consistent set of standards and guidelines as those issues arise in the workplace. In addition to a focus on great food and welcoming, attentive service, Baker intends to build on her professionalism and passion for advocacy to prioritize a healthy, comfortable, and inclusive atmosphere for the Mundano team as well as for guests.

Owners – The Abu-Taleb brothers have a long history in Chicago’s dining scene. Together they founded LetUsCater.com, an online ordering catering service that connects consumers with over a hundred restaurants in the Chicagoland area. In 2016, they opened Mesa Urbana, a Mexican bistro in Glenview, with plans to open a second location. Diners at Mundano can expect the same thoughtful consideration and attention to detail as their other projects, but with the unique vision of Chef Ross Henke and Manager Trista Baker, they hope to provide the neighborhood with an affordable price point and a creative, explorative experience that will place this restaurant into a league of its own.  

Mundano will be opening Winter 2020 and will be located at 1935 N Lincoln Park West. The restaurant will be open 7 days a week for dinner service. Extended hours for the lounge and brunch to follow in the coming months.
